Prestonville, KY Profile
Prestonville, KY, population 173, is located
in Kentucky's Carroll county,
about 42.6 miles from Louisville and 51.7 miles from Cincinnati.
Through the 90's Prestonville's population has declined by about 20%.
It is estimated that in the first 5 years of this decade the population of Prestonville has grown by about 5%.
